Title: Tennessee Valley Authority National Fertilizer and Environmental Research Center. An overview

The National Fertilizer and Environmental Research Center (NFERC) is a unique part of the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A), a government agency created by an Act of Congress in 1933. The Center, located in Muscle Shoals, Alabama, is a national laboratory for research, development, education and commercialization for fertilizers and related agricultural chemicals including their economic and environmentally safe use, renewable fuel and chemical technologies, alternatives for solving environmental/waste problems, and technologies which support national defense- NFERC projects in the pesticide waste minimization/treatment/disposal areas include ``Model Site Demonstrations and Site Assessments,`` ``Development of Waste Treatment and Site Remediation Technologies for Fertilizer/Agrichemical Dealers,`` ``Development of a Dealer Information/Education Program,`` and ``Constructed Wetlands.``
